OBJECTIVES Terbinafine (Lamisil), a widely prescribed oral antifungal agent, reportedly induces taste loss in 0.6% to 2.8% of those taking the drug. However, many so-called taste problems reflect olfactory problems, and the sole empirical study published on this topic, based on whole-mouth testing of a single subject, found no terbinafine-related deficit. -Object oriented software systems are subject to frequent modifications either during development (iterative, agile software development) or software evolution. For such systems which have large number of classes, detection of design defects is a complex task. Bad smells are used to identify design defects in object oriented software design. Although evidence is mixed, studies have shown that blind individuals perform better than sighted at specific auditory, tactile, and chemosensory tasks. However, few studies have assessed blind and sighted individuals across different sensory modalities in the same study. Olfactory dysfunction is common among older adults and affects their safety, nutrition, quality of life, and mortality. More importantly, the decreased sense of smell is an early symptom of neurodegenerative diseases such as Parkinson disease (PD) and Alzheimer disease.
